If you are publishing a journal article in the health sciences, consult the instructions for authors database or the journal website to find out what citation style they require your references to be formatted in. If you are writing a paper for a course, ask your professors what citation style they recommend.

Keep the note in the same font and size as the rest of the paper, and double-space the text. The first line of text is indented five spaces. The notes should begin with the superscript numeral. These are called APA footnotes even when they are listed at the end. Many styles are also provided for different journal titles that have their own styles. You may also list all notes at the end of the paper, after the references page.
